Settings
•Alarm Delay:
When the conditions for the High or Low Temperature Alarm are reached, the alarm buzzer will sound
after the alarm delay time set her as elapsed.
Settable range: 0 minute~15 minutes, factory setting: 15 minutes.
Note: When conditions return to normal within the alarm delay time, the buzzer does not sound after the
elapse of the alarm delay.
•Door Delay:
When the conditions for the door alarm are reached, the alarm buzzer will sound after the alarm delay
time set here has elapsed. Settable range: 0 minute~15 minutes, factory setting: 2 minutes.
Note: When conditions return to normal within the door alarm delay time, the buzzer does not sound after
the elapse of the door alarm delay.
•Ring Back:
If the alarm buzzer is stopped by pressing the "Buzzer" key, the buzzer will sound again when the
conditions that activated the alarm continue after the time set here has elapsed.
Settable range: 1 minute~99 minutes, factory setting: 30 minutes.
Note: For the Door alarm, the alarm is deactivated by pressing the Buzzer key and so the buzzer will not
sound again [page 49].
•Remote Alarm:
The remote alarm continues even though the buzzer is stopped by pressing the Buzzer key if Remote
Alarm function is turned ON (not in conjunction with the Buzzer key). Factory setting: ON.
